Sem categoria

How History Shapes Today’s Smart Algorithms

The Evolution of Algorithms: From Ancient Logic to Artificial Intelligence

a. Early algorithmic thinking emerged in Babylonian mathematics, where cuneiform tablets reveal systematic approaches to solving linear equations and geometric problems—foundations that echo in modern computational logic. Euclidean geometry formalized step-by-step deduction, establishing the first structured framework for algorithmic reasoning.
b. Medieval scholars refined rule-based systems, especially through the works of logicians like William of Ockham, whose principles of parsimony and classification foreshadowed formal computational logic. These traditions, preserved and expanded in Islamic and European academies, seeded the formalism that powered 20th-century cybernetic theory.
c. The cybernetic revolution—championed by Norbert Wiener—transformed abstract logic into programmable machines, bridging mathematical abstraction with real-time decision-making, a bridge still vital to today’s adaptive algorithms.

Historical Foundations of Adaptive Rule-Based Systems

a. Nineteenth-century formal logic, notably George Boole’s algebra and Frege’s predicate logic, directly influenced modern decision algorithms. Their binary and symbolic systems underpin everything from search engines to AI classifiers.
b. Turing machines embodied the conceptual leap toward programmable logic, proving that computation could simulate any algorithmic process—a breakthrough enabling today’s flexible, self-learning systems.
c. Wartime cryptography, particularly the work at Bletchley Park with Enigma decryption, accelerated pattern recognition technologies, laying groundwork for machine learning’s ability to detect hidden structures in data.

Case Study: How Ancient Counting Systems Inform Modern Machine Learning

a. The abacus, a 2,500-year-old counting device, introduced core principles of data structure and sequential processing still embedded in optimization algorithms. Its bead-based logic mirrors modern vector operations in neural networks.
b. The shift from manual calculation to automated inference engines reflects a deep continuity: early scribes’ meticulous tabulation evolved into today’s automated data pipelines that train and refine algorithms at scale.
c. Historical challenges in scaling computations—such as resource limits and error propagation—remain critical learning points, underscoring the need for resilient, adaptive design in modern AI systems.

Historical Bias and Ethical Design in Smart Algorithms

a. Algorithmic bias traces roots to historical data collection and classification systems, where social hierarchies and cultural assumptions shaped early datasets. Colonial-era censuses, for example, encoded skewed representations that persist in modern training data.
b. Past social structures—gender roles, racial categorizations—continue to shape fairness challenges in algorithmic fairness, demanding awareness beyond technical fixes to include historical context.
c. Understanding these origins empowers developers to implement proactive bias detection and inclusive design, turning historical insight into ethical innovation.

From Gutenberg to Generative AI: The Long Arc of Algorithmic Transmission

a. The printing press revolutionized information dissemination, introducing mass production of knowledge—an early “smart” distribution system that parallels today’s recommendation algorithms.
b. Content curation evolved from scribes to AI-driven personalization, with each era refining how context is preserved—or lost—across technological shifts.
c. Despite progress, the core challenge remains: maintaining fidelity of intent and meaning across evolving formats and platforms.

The Hidden Legacy of Historical Problem-Solving in Algorithm Development

a. Ancient engineers and mathematicians solved complex problems through trial, debate, and iterative design—methods mirrored in modern A/B testing and reinforcement learning.
b. Historical problem-solving emphasized resilience and adaptation, qualities increasingly vital in training algorithms to navigate uncertain, dynamic environments.
c. Cross-temporal insight fosters creativity, revealing that today’s AI breakthroughs are not isolated but part of a continuum of human ingenuity.

Why Understanding History Deepens Algorithmic Literacy Today

a. Recognizing repeated patterns across centuries strengthens critical evaluation of algorithmic behavior and its societal impact.
b. Historical context clarifies why certain design choices persist—sometimes due to legacy constraints, sometimes due to inertia—enabling more thoughtful redesign.
c. Building intelligent, accountable algorithms begins with honoring their deep roots, ensuring innovation respects the wisdom and mistakes of the past.

“Algorithms are not born in a vacuum; they are the sum of humanity’s cumulative effort to solve problems with logic, structure, and context.”

Understanding this historical arc transforms how we engage with smart systems—from passive users to informed stewards of ethical, effective AI. A compelling illustration appears in the evolution of recommendation engines: from hand-crafted ranking rules inspired by literary and philosophical canons, to today’s machine learning models trained on vast datasets shaped by centuries of knowledge transmission.

Explore how game theory shapes algorithmic decision-making and modern strategic AI systems

Key Historical Milestone Modern Parallel
Babylonian linear equations Linear algebra in neural networks
Euclidean geometry proofs Symbolic AI rule engines
Turing’s theoretical machine Programmable, general-purpose AI
Bletchley Park cryptanalysis Pattern recognition in machine learning

“Algorithms endure not by chance, but through the persistent human impulse to reason, adapt, and transmit knowledge across generations.”

By studying history, we gain not only insight but also clarity—enabling smarter design, deeper accountability, and a richer understanding of the intelligent systems shaping our world today.